Special Occasions and Celebrations

When it comes to special occasions, the OSC Islamic Center Bekasi truly shines. The two major Islamic festivals, Eid al-Fitr and Eid al-Adha, are celebrated with immense joy and fervor. Eid al-Fitr, marking the end of Ramadan, is a time of thanksgiving, forgiveness, and feasting. The center organizes grand congregational prayers, followed by gatherings where families and friends come together to celebrate. The spirit of sharing and generosity is palpable, with many members participating in zakat al-fitr (charity given before Eid prayers) facilitated by the center. Eid al-Adha, the Festival of Sacrifice, holds a different kind of significance. The center plays a crucial role in organizing the communal sacrifice of animals, ensuring that the meat is distributed equitably to those in need, both within the community and beyond. This embodies the spirit of sacrifice and compassion that the festival represents. Beyond these two major Eids, the center often commemorates other significant Islamic dates, such as Mawlid an-Nabi (the Prophet Muhammad's birthday), with special lectures, recitations, and discussions aimed at reflecting on his life and teachings. The start of the Islamic New Year (Hijrah) is also often observed, serving as a reminder of the importance of migration and commitment to faith. The center might also host events during Laylat al-Qadr (the Night of Decree), the holiest night of the year, encouraging heightened worship and reflection.
